Background
Aquaculture is the production activity of breeding, cultivating and harvesting aquatic animals and plants under artificial control.
At present, the mandarin fish in a laboratory mostly depends on manual feeding one by one and timely fishing out residual baits to obtain more accurate food intake, calculate the feed efficiency (tail weight gain/tail food intake), and simultaneously reduce feed waste and pollution to the water quality in a culture tank. However, the feeding speed of the mandarin fish is slow, the water surface needs to be stirred continuously, feeding is time-consuming for a long time, and the mandarin fish belongs to benthic freshwater fish, is fond of still water with dark light, is mostly cultured at a depth of more than 1.5m, and is difficult to observe the time when the mandarin fish stops feeding and bait begins to fall to the bottom of a cylinder and stop feeding in time.

Detailed Description
In order to make the objects and advantages of the present invention more apparent, the following detailed description of the present invention with reference to the examples should be understood that the following text is only intended to describe one or several specific embodiments of the present invention, and does not strictly limit the scope of the invention as specifically claimed, and as used herein, the terms up, down, left and right are not limited to their strict geometric definitions, but include tolerances for machining or human error rationality and inconsistency, the specific features of this kind of aquaculture timing feeding device are detailed below:
referring to fig. 1-8, according to the utility model discloses an aquaculture regularly throws feeding device of embodiment, including storing up bait section of thick bamboo 10, it is fixed with apron 12 to store up bait section of thick bamboo 10 up end, apron 12 up end is fixed with handle 11, it is fixed with last connecting rod 13 to store up bait section of thick bamboo 10 down end, end fixing has motor cabinet 14 under last connecting rod 13, motor cabinet 14 downside is provided with screw 27, screw 27 downside is provided with lower connecting rod 15, end fixing has filter screen 17 under the lower connecting rod 15, the hole diameter of filter screen 17 is less than the size of incomplete bait, make incomplete bait stop on filter screen 17, filter screen 17 up end is fixed with infrared sensor 16, infrared sensor 16 is the common waterproof infrared sensor in market, can detect whether there is mandarin fish to swim above it.
The interior of the bait storage barrel 10 is provided with a bait storage bin 18 with an upward opening, the lower side of the Chu Ercang 18 is communicated with a conical cavity 22, the lower side of the conical cavity 22 is communicated with a bait distribution disc cavity 23, the lower side of the bait distribution disc cavity 23 is communicated with a discharge hole 25, and the lower end of the discharge hole 25 is provided with an opening.
A bait casting motor 24 fixedly arranged on the bait storage barrel 10 is arranged at the lower side of the bait distribution disc cavity 23, the upper end of the bait casting motor 24 is in power connection with a motor shaft 20, and the upper side part of the motor shaft 20 extends upwards into the bait distribution disc cavity 23.
A bait separating disc 19 is fixed on the periphery of the motor shaft 20, the bait separating disc 19 is positioned in a bait separating disc cavity 23, a bait separating groove 21 which is through up and down is arranged in the bait separating disc 19, and one end of the outer side of the bait separating groove 21 is provided with an opening.
A timer 29 is fixed in the motor base 14, a stirring motor 28 fixed with the motor base 14 is arranged at the lower side of the timer 29, and the timer 29 is a common timer in the market and can drive the stirring motor 28 to be started at regular time.
A protective cover 26 is fixed on the periphery of the motor base 14, a propeller 27 is positioned in the protective cover 26, and the upper end of the propeller 27 is in power connection with the lower end of a stirring motor 28.
The lower connecting rod 15 is fixed to the lower end surface of the protective cover 26.
When in specific use:
bait is stored in a bait storage bin 18, a filter screen 17 is placed in water, and a motor base 14 is located below the water surface.
The agitator motor 28 is timed to start under the control of a timer 29.
When the agitator motor 28 is activated, the propeller 27 rotates so that the water flow around the propeller 27 is agitated by it, thereby attracting the mandarin fish to feed.
The protective cover 26 prevents the mandarin fish from being scratched by the rotating propeller 27 when the mandarin fish swims around the propeller 27.
At this time, the infrared sensor 16 detects that the mandarin fish swims over the upper side of the mandarin fish, and the infrared sensor 16 transmits a signal to the bait casting motor 24, so that the bait casting motor 24 is started.
At this time, the bait feeding motor 24 drives the motor shaft 20 to rotate, so that the bait dividing disc 19 rotates, when the bait dividing groove 21 in the bait dividing disc rotates to the lower side of the conical cavity 22, the bait in the Chu Ercang falls into the bait dividing groove 21, then the bait dividing disc 19 rotates to drive the bait in the bait dividing groove 21 to move to the upper side of the discharge port 25, and then the bait in the bait dividing groove 21 falls through the discharge port 25.
The bait falls down into the water, so as to feed the mandarin fish.
The mandarin fish forages on the upper side of the filter screen 17, and residual baits fall to the upper side of the filter screen 17.
When the foraging time has expired, the timer 29 is switched off, so that the stirring motor 28 is switched off, the water flow stops stirring, and after the mandarin fish has free, the infrared sensor 16 stops transmitting a signal to the bait casting motor 24, so that the bait scoring disc 19 stops rotating, so that downward feeding of bait stops.
